How many battery energy storage projects are there?
The U.S. has 575 operational battery energy storage projects 8, using lead-acid, lithium-ion, nickel-based, sodium-based, and flow batteries 10. These projects totaled 15.9 GW of rated power in 2023 8, and have round-trip efficiencies between 60-95% 24.
When was the first battery invented?
The first battery—called Volta’s cell—was developed in 1800. 2 The first U.S. large-scale energy storage facility was the Rocky River Pumped Storage plant in 1929. 3 Research on energy storage has increased dramatically 2, especially after the first oil crisis in the 1970s 4, and has resulted in advancements in cost and performance of batteries 5.

When was the first rechargeable battery invented?
The first rechargeable battery came in 1859 when Gaston Plant Planté invented the lead acid rechargeable battery. This was achieved by immersing a lead anode and cathode in sulfuric acid to produce lead sulfate. The reaction at the anode released electrons and the reaction at the cathode consumed them, creating a flow of electricity.
